/// <summary> /// Unregisters a handler from the provider. /// </summary> /// <param name="handler">The handler to unregister</param> public void Unregister(IMeshHandler handler) { lock (this.Registry) { this.Registry.Remove(handler); } }
/// <summary> /// Registers a handler to the provider. /// </summary> /// <param name="handler">The handler to register</param> public void Register(IMeshHandler handler) { lock (this.Registry) { this.Registry.Add(handler); } }